I'm trying to share an internet connection with 2 comptuers the host is a Win ME, and my client is a Win95. I can connect to the internet on the Win Me computer and use the network. But on my client computer the internet does not work. TCP/IP settings are correct and I can ping web address on the client. But the internet just doesn't work.
